Discipline Investigation

Purpose: To investigate a discourse community* (e.g. profession) you hope to join and to learn about the kinds of texts (genres) that community uses. This

assignment will enable you to identify some of those rules or patterns by interviewing a professional in your field of study and by doing outside research

Audience: Your instructor, your classmates, and other faculty members on the 100A portfolio committee.

*Discourse Community: Any group of people who form a community—a family, a neighborhood, colleagues, practitioners of a particular profession—and establish

informal and formal rules regarding who gets to join their community and how spoken and written interactions (i.e. discourse) occur within the community.

Anyone who wants to join that community has to learn its discourse rules and patterns.
